HMM-based Speech Synthesis with an Acoustic Glottal Source Model
نویسندگان
چکیده
A major cause of degradation of speech quality in HMMbased speech synthesis is the use of a simple delta pulse signal to generate the excitation of voiced speech. This paper describes a new approach to using an acoustic glottal source model in HMM-based synthesisers. The goal is to improve speech quality and parametric flexibility to better model and transform voice characteristics.
